lrcShow-X 2.0.0公测版发布

lrcShow-X是Linux下实用的lrc显示工具。支持绑定不少音乐播放器。可自定义多种歌词显示方式,十分好用。

最近这个软件发布了2.0.0公测版本,希望大家能够协助找出bug,改进软件。

下载及原文地址:http://www.sanfanling.cn/read.php?308#entrymore

下面是作者的博客发布原文:

经过一段时间的潜心code,昨天大致上完成了主要编写工作,正式进入公测阶段。这次的改变还是比较大的,但是整体大的架构上没有本质改变。本来是想好好改一下架构的,但是后来发现,目前的架构还是非常不错的,各个步骤和功能分割还是很有道理的。所以主要还是修改了一些不合理的地方,并且增加了许多新的功能和特性,因此这次版本号是以2.0.0出现。

总体上,预计和将来最终版还是会有一些变化的,主要是本来就想好的一个sqlite的数据库,和窗口的可拉伸问题——这个问题从lrcShow-II时代就一直想搞定,但是鉴于当时的代码,总是很头痛,改了这里,那里就不好处理了。经过这次的修改,突然发现以前的羁绊都一下子没有了。头脑风暴了一下,似乎是这样的,不过这个改动还需要一些时间思考一下,就先拿出当前的版本作为公测对象。代码上的改动毕竟还是比较大的,可能会引入新的bug,甚至以前灭掉的bug又会死灰复燃。所以为了保证正式版的质量,尝试一下公测还是觉得有必要的。

说一下这个版本的一些主要改动:

1. 增加了一个初次运行的向导。考虑到lrcShow-X的参数配置相对还是比较麻烦的,为了方便刚上手的朋友能够在最短的时间正常的使用,新增了这个向导。主要是对歌词路径上的设置,搞定这个就可以初步使用。
2. 将单行横向滚动,从显示行数的范畴中彻底剥离为一种显示模式
3. 修正了透明窗口上的bug。正因为灭掉了这个bug,我就可以放心的打开记忆上次退出时的透明状态。
4. 改进了配置文件的升级系统,目前已经是安静化的升级了,不需要再进行第二次启动。
5. 可以在播放器运行前,运行lrcShow-X。这里的机制是:当没有检测到可支持播放器运行时,启动一个对话框,让用户选择播放器,并启动之。
6. 大幅改进了歌词搜索逻辑。这个方面,用户体验不会太明显
7. 重写了策略设置窗口,现在是合并到音轨信息窗口中
8. 彻底重写了参数配置对话框
9. 增加对clementine的支持
10. 增加tuneWiki搜索引擎
11. 修复在全屏模式下,修改字体后歌词无法居中的bug
等等

提一下测试时,需要注意的问题:

1. 删掉原先的配置文件
2. 可以保留原先的db数据库文件
3. 报告问题时,最好能贴出中端输出
4. 鉴于当前广告泛滥,本blog的留言可能会需要验证通过,抱歉了

不过,由于合作者的原因,对播放器支持这部分代码没有变动,不过还是希望朋友能够将测试出来的问题提出来。

此帖即为这个公测版本的问题报告贴,有问题敬请提出来,我将一一回复,确认的问题将跟踪到底。

No views yet

Now have 2 Responses to “lrcShow-X 2.0.0公测版发布”

  1. haulm 2011-03-31 13:48 says: 回复

    这个好。

  2. hew 2011-03-31 20:52 says: 回复

    是三的作品哦

发表评论